Tips For King Size Mattress Buyers

Furniture Add comments

Many first time mattress buyers make the mistake of choosing one that is too small for the bed. One of the major reasons for this is not having an idea about one’s bed dimensions. Mattress dimensions are also pretty hazy for most buyers. You can check the bed sizes discussed below to make a better choice when trying the models at one of the mattress discounters. You can take your pick from a king size mattress, queen size mattress or full size mattress.

King Mattresses

King size beds are usually 80 inches long and 76 inches wide. Queen size mattresses are much smaller than these. The king mattress also gives users more space than a pair of twin mattresses side by side. The mattress has space galore and is a good choice for families with children or keeping pets. The room will seem congested if the mattress occupies it completely. You can make this huge mattress manageable by using a twin bed foundation. Narrow stairways and corridors can make transport difficult. The “California King” version available on the west coast is shorter and wider with dimensions of 84 by 72 inches.

Queen Size Variety

The queen size mattress is larger than the full size mattress but much smaller than the king size mattress. These mattresses are 80 inches long and 60 inches wide. The abundance of space makes them much more comfortable as compared to a full size mattress. Couples opt for the queen size mattress frequently. You can easily fit this bed into a small bedroom. The mattress is a good idea for guest rooms which are typically smaller than the other bed rooms. You can also furnish an accessory bedroom with a queen size mattress. For those who sprawl, the queen size mattress makes the best choice.

Full Size Mattress

Double or full size beds measure 75 by 53 inches. These feel cramped when compared to a king size bed. They are about 15 inches wider than the regular twin size beds in the market. The length of these beds may not be enough for taller people. You can take this mattress if you are a single sleeper of average height. This is a better option as compared to twin beds, especially for children.
